A Look At Array Technologies (ARRY) Valuation After Baird Downgrade And Recent Rally

Simply Wall St

Baird’s downgrade of Array Technologies (ARRY) from Outperform to Neutral, following a strong recent rally and concerns about future margins as competition increases, has become the key focus for investors assessing the stock.

Array Technologies’ 90 day share price return of 46.51% and 30 day gain of 16.99% suggest recent momentum has been strong. The 61.32% 1 year total shareholder return contrasts with weaker 3 and 5 year outcomes, which hints that sentiment has only turned more constructive relatively recently.

With ARRY trading close to its analyst price target and carrying a loss of US$92.105 million on revenue of US$1.333b, is the recent surge leaving upside on the table, or is the market already pricing in future growth?

Most Popular Narrative: 3.2% Overvalued

With Array Technologies’ fair value estimate at $10.97 versus a last close of $11.33, the most widely followed narrative sees only a modest gap to the current price, and anchors that view in a detailed set of growth and profitability assumptions.

Continued industry tailwinds from large-scale decarbonization initiatives, falling solar power costs, and heightened corporate ESG/net-zero commitments signal robust multi-year demand for utility-scale solar and tracking solutions, providing a favorable backdrop for long-term revenue, backlog growth, and sustained earnings momentum.

However, there is still the risk that shifting tariffs and policy rules, as well as a tougher pricing backdrop in trackers, could undermine the margin and earnings recovery that this narrative assumes.

Another View on Value

While the fair value estimate of $10.97 suggests Array Technologies is about 3.2% overvalued, the current P/S of 1.3x screens as cheap next to both peers at 2.3x and the US Electrical industry at 2.4x, and below a fair ratio of 1.7x, which raises the question of whether sentiment or fundamentals are driving that gap.
